Jody_manders wrote:
Good evening,
I’ve tried contacting netgear about this but still waiting for a response. I bought a nighthawk router used and when I try to go register it, it won’t let me cause it’s been registered. Is there anything netgear support can do to fix this so I can register it?
Thank you.
-CF
Most likely not. The big thing is that registration is of no value for a used device. Warranty is gone, registration is not necessary to reset the router, configure the router, update the firmware, or otherwise use the router.

Jody_manders wrote:
Thanks for replying to my post. Yeah I just wanted to register the used router so i can have it integrated into the nighthawk app so I can utilize it.You can create a Netgear account and you do not have to register the router in order to use the Nighthawk mobile application. Install the mobile application, connect your mobile device to the Wi-Fi, log in to your Netgear account, and within the application you can Add the router in the setup a new device section. The router does not have to be a registered device.
I run a router I bought second hand. I have added it to the mobile application and the device shows up as registered. Most likely by the original owner but not to me or by me. During this process, the mobile application asked me for the Wi-Fi user name (admin) and my Wi-Fi password.
